'Potter' passes 'Rings'

With help from a strong opening in China,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ows Part 2 reached its final major milestone this weekend. On Sunday, it passed The Lord of the Rings: The Return of the King to move up to third place on the all-time worldwide (domestic plus foreign) chart with $1.134 billion.
